Title: **The Innovative Journey of Serge Ratton**
Introduction
Serge Ratton, based in Saint Germain en Laye, France, is a distinguished inventor known for his significant contributions to the field of chemistry. With an impressive portfolio of 23 patents, Ratton has made a remarkable impact through his innovative inventions that address complex chemical processes.
Latest Patents
Among his latest patents, Ratton has developed processes that are critical to modern chemistry. One notable patent is the **Process for the preparation of halogenated derivatives and Lewis acid base catalysts thereof**. This invention outlines a method for producing halide compounds, especially aryl halides, by interacting a gaseous mixture of hydrohalic acid with various aryl halogen forms in the presence of a Lewis acid catalyst. Another of his groundbreaking patents is the **Esterification of hydroxybenzoic acids**, where hydroxybenzoic acids such as salicylic acid are esterified using a halocarbon in a homogeneous liquid phase and with the aid of a nonquaternizable tertiary amine. These inventions showcase his expertise in organic chemistry and his ability to innovate in complex chemical processes.
Career Highlights
Throughout his career, Serge Ratton has worked with reputable companies, including Rhone-Poulenc Specialités Chimiques and Rhone-Poulenc Chimie. His tenure at these organizations has provided him with a robust platform to advance his research and drive his inventive efforts forward.
Collaborations
Ratton has also collaborated with esteemed colleagues in the industry, including Jean-Roger Desmurs and Jean-Luc Bougeois. These partnerships have fostered a collaborative environment, leading to breakthroughs in chemical innovation and patent development.
